Financial Performance - Yonghui Supermarkets reported a revenue of RMB 48.73 billion for the first half of 2022, an increase of 4.07% compared to RMB 46.83 billion in the same period last year[14]. - The net profit attributable to shareholders was a loss of RMB 111.77 million, while the net profit after deducting non-recurring gains and losses was RMB 94.10 million, showing an increase of RMB 971 million and RMB 1.02 billion respectively compared to the previous year[16]. - The gross profit margin improved from 18.82% in the previous year to 20.35% in the current period, contributing to the reduction in net loss[16]. - The net cash flow from operating activities was RMB 4.31 billion, representing a 13.32% increase from RMB 3.80 billion in the same period last year[14]. - The company achieved total revenue of 48.732 billion yuan, a year-on-year increase of 4.07%[21]. - Same-store sales increased by 4.2%, with double-digit growth in April[21]. - The net profit attributable to shareholders was -112 million yuan, with a comprehensive gross margin increase of 1.53%[21]. - Online business revenue reached 7.59 billion yuan, growing 11.5% year-on-year, accounting for 15.7% of total revenue[22]. - The company reported a significant increase in asset disposal income, which rose by 389.22% to approximately ¥146.52 million[35]. - The company reported a significant reduction in online business losses, with a loss rate of 1.6%[22]. Assets and Liabilities - As of the end of the reporting period, the net assets attributable to shareholders were RMB 10.37 billion, a decrease of 2.75% from RMB 10.66 billion at the end of the previous year[15]. - The total assets decreased by 9.95% from RMB 71.31 billion to RMB 64.22 billion[15]. - The company's total liabilities were ¥53.51 billion, down from ¥60.23 billion, indicating a decrease of approximately 11.4%[110]. - The company's current assets totaled ¥23.02 billion, down from ¥28.71 billion at the beginning of the period, reflecting a decrease of approximately 19.7%[108]. - The company's total equity attributable to shareholders decreased to ¥10.37 billion from ¥10.66 billion, a decline of about 2.7%[110]. - The company reported a significant decrease in short-term loans by 48.83%, totaling ¥291 million at the end of the period[44]. - Long-term loans increased by 120.59% to ¥2.25 billion, reflecting a strategic shift from short-term to long-term financing[45]. Store Operations and Expansion - The company opened 20 new supermarket stores in the first half of 2022, with a total area of 121,800 square meters, while closing 17 stores[23]. - There are 137 signed but unopened stores, with a total area of 994,700 square meters[23]. - The company has over 1,060 operational stores across 29 provinces and municipalities, covering more than 8 million square meters[19]. - The total area of stores across the country reached approximately 8.25 million square meters, with significant expansions in regions like Sichuan and Chongqing[29]. Legal and Compliance Issues - The company is involved in a rental contract dispute with a total claim amount of 15,970,300 RMB, which has not formed an expected liability[60]. - The company has a pending arbitration case regarding a rental contract with a claim for 10 million RMB in renovation subsidies, plus overdue penalties calculated at a daily rate of 0.05%[62]. - The company has faced multiple legal disputes related to rental agreements, impacting its operational stability and financial obligations[60][61][63]. - The company has initiated legal proceedings to recover losses from rental agreements, indicating ongoing challenges in its leasing operations[62]. - The company is currently awaiting the outcome of several legal proceedings that may affect its financial position and operational strategy[63]. Shareholder Information - The total number of ordinary shareholders as of the end of the reporting period is 227,518[100]. - The largest shareholder, Milk Co., Ltd., holds 1,913,135,376 shares, accounting for 21.08% of total shares[101]. - The total number of shares outstanding is 9,075,036,993[98]. - The top ten shareholders collectively hold a significant portion of the company's shares, with the largest holding being 21.08%[101]. Research and Development - Research and development expenses surged by 141.09% to approximately ¥243.64 million, compared to ¥101.06 million in the previous year[35]. - The company's investment in wealth management products increased from 326,204,366.55 RMB to 482,338,596.74 RMB, with a current period change of 156,134,230.19 RMB[48]. Cash Flow and Financial Management - The company's cash and cash equivalents decreased to ¥8.06 billion from ¥9.16 billion, a decline of about 12.0%[108]. - The company reported a total cash inflow from financing activities of ¥1.90 billion, a decrease from ¥15.97 billion in the previous year, indicating a decline of approximately 88%[123]. - The net cash flow from financing activities was -¥4.10 billion, compared to -¥968.56 million in the first half of 2021, indicating a worsening of cash flow by approximately 323%[124]. Taxation and Incentives - The main tax rates applicable include a 25% corporate income tax rate, with some subsidiaries benefiting from reduced rates of 15% or 0%[192][193]. - The group enjoys various tax incentives, including a 15% corporate income tax rate for certain subsidiaries under the Western Development Strategy until December 31, 2030[195]. Accounting Policies - The company’s financial statements are prepared in accordance with the accounting standards issued by the Ministry of Finance[135]. - The company recognizes revenue when control of goods or services is transferred to the customer, typically at the point of delivery[182]. - The company measures financial instruments' impairment using an expected credit loss model, which requires significant judgment and estimation based on historical repayment data and macroeconomic indicators[188].
